Lloret de Mar is one of Costa Brava’s most dynamic destinations, offering an unbeatable combination of beaches, leisure, and services for all ages. Its Airbnb market is very powerful, boasting an occupancy rate of 57%. Visitors seek everything from budget-friendly city-center apartments to luxury villas with pools in the surrounding hills, generating an annual revenue of €43,154. Its ability to attract large groups and families throughout the season ensures high and consistent profitability for owners.

Roses, in northern Costa Brava, features a spectacular bay blending sandy beaches with wild coves in the Cap de Creus Natural Park. It is a well-established family and nautical destination, primarily attracting French and domestic tourists. The vacation rental market is very active here, with an annual revenue of €28,727. Visitors value ocean-view apartments and homes in quiet developments like Santa Margarita or Canyelles, taking advantage of an average daily rate of €143 to enjoy one of Catalonia’s finest maritime environments.

Castelló d'Empúries and its coastal hub Empuriabrava form the largest residential marina in Europe, a unique destination with over 24 km of navigable canals. It is a highly attractive market for nautical and adventure tourism (skydiving). Vacation rentals are very dynamic here, with an annual revenue of €30,191. Visitors seek homes with private moorings and apartments overlooking the canals or the Bay of Roses, taking advantage of an average daily rate of €149 in a setting that blends medieval history with nautical modernity, ensuring steady international demand.

Palafrugell, the heart of the Costa Brava with its hubs of Calella, Llafranc, and Tamariu, offers Catalonia’s most idyllic and traditional coastal landscape. It is a high-quality market attracting a loyal domestic and international crowd seeking the Mediterranean “good life.” Vacation rentals are premium here, featuring an average daily rate of €235. Restored fisherman’s houses and villas with cove views are the star properties, generating an annual revenue of €48,822. Its timeless charm and gastronomy ensure exclusive demand and solid profitability.

Begur is undoubtedly one of the most prestigious municipalities on the Costa Brava, famous for its medieval castle and dreamlike coves like Aiguablava or Sa Tuna. It is an exclusive market with an offer dominated by luxury villas and high-character homes. Vacation rentals are very profitable here, reaching an average daily rate of €295. Visitors seek privacy and the spectacular setting of its seaside pine forests, generating an annual revenue of €62,867. Its reputation as a select destination and its unmatched beauty ensure a safe investment and demand from high-net-worth travelers.

L'Escala, famous for its anchovies and the Greco-Roman ruins of Empúries, is a destination merging culture, gastronomy, and spectacular seascapes. Its fishing port and family-friendly beaches attract a peaceful, culturally-minded crowd. The vacation rental market is very solid here, with an annual revenue of €31,996. Visitors seek detached homes with gardens and apartments overlooking the Bay of Roses, taking advantage of an average daily rate of €160. Its authenticity and diverse offerings ensure steady demand from domestic and European families seeking the essence of the Costa Brava.

Castell-Platja d'Aro blends the commercial energy and nightlife of Platja d'Aro with the medieval charm of Castell d'Aro and the elegance of S'Agaró. It is a well-rounded destination attracting visitors year-round. The Airbnb market is very active here, boasting an occupancy rate of 55%. Visitors especially value centrally located apartments and luxury villas in exclusive areas, generating an annual revenue of €35,159. Its ability to offer shopping, high-quality beaches, and constant events ensures high profitability for hosts in the heart of the Costa Brava.

Calonge i Sant Antoni offers the best of both worlds: the historic and wine-growing charm of inland Calonge and the family-friendly beaches of coastal Sant Antoni. It is a very balanced market attracting lovers of wine, culture, and the sea. Vacation rentals are of high quality here, reaching an average daily rate of €239. Villas with pools in quiet developments and oceanfront apartments are the most sought-after properties, generating an annual revenue of €52,001. Its diverse offerings and serene atmosphere ensure steady demand from European and domestic families.

Torroella de Montgrí and L'Estartit form a unique destination, dominated by the Montgrí massif and the Medes Islands, a scuba diving paradise. It is a market with a very strong nature and sports component attracting specialized international tourism. The Airbnb market is very active here, with an occupancy rate of 60%. Visitors seek apartments with island views or traditional homes in the town, generating an annual revenue of €34,500. Its combination of heritage, natural parks, and nautical activities ensures steady demand and solid profitability.

Cadaqués, the most iconic and secluded village on the Costa Brava, is a labyrinth of white houses and cobblestone streets that captivated Dalí. It is a global luxury and exclusivity market attracting sophisticated bohemian tourists seeking art, sea, and absolute peace. Vacation rentals are extraordinarily profitable here, featuring a record average daily rate of €224. Visitors seek homes with Mediterranean charm and apartments with spectacular bay views, generating an annual revenue of €42,781. Its geographical isolation and unmatched beauty ensure high-level demand and exceptional profitability.
